- add vips_premultiply(), vips_unpremultiply()
|
||||
- change the alpha range rules for vips_flatten() to match vips_premultiply()
|
||||
- vipsthumbnail uses vips_resize() rather than its own code
|
||||
- vipsthumbnail uses vips_premultiply() for better alpha quality
